Facilities

The campground offers single and double family campsites, which have 30-amp electric hookups. Each site is equipped with a picnic table and campfire ring. Flush toilets, drinking water and showers are provided. Ice and firewood are sold on-site. Limited groceries can be found at Grove Marina.

Natural Features

The campground is in close proximity to the lake and is less than a mile from the shoreline. Laurel River Lake boasts 5,600 acres of deep, clear water and 192 miles of cliff-lined shores. Bountiful hills and valleys create a beautiful backdrop for the lake area. The forest was named after Daniel Boone, a famous frontiersman and explorer who settled in Kentucky in the late 18th century.

Recreation

Hikers, horseback riders and mountain bikers can trek more than 600 miles of road and trail in Daniel Boone National Forest. Duff Branch, Oak Branch, Fishing Point and Singing Hills Trails can all be accessed in the immediate area. Anglers find prized catches of walleye, crappie, brown trout and rainbow trout at Laurel River Lake. Boating and swimming are also popular activities. A boat ramp is located nearby at Grove Marina.

Important notices

Campsite Occupancy & Vehicle Policy: Each single campsite is limited to 6 people and 2 vehicles. Double sites are limited to 12 people and 4 vehicles. Cars, trucks, trailers, boats, motorcycles ,etc. ARE considered vehicles. One boat or trailer per site only. All vehicles must be parked in designated parking areas only. Parking on roadsides, grass, or non-designated areas is not permitted. If space allows, additional vehicles may be permitted for a $10 fee per vehicle. However, extra vehicles may be refused if parking is not available. All additional vehicles must exit the campground by 10:00 PM, unless parked in an approved designated parking area. Guests are responsible for ensuring their party complies with all occupancy and vehicle limits.
DO NOT move or tamper with fire-rings, bear boxes, picnic tables and etc.
Be sure to reserve a site that will accommodate your equipment. The site you reserve is your site. You may not move to another site.
High cliffs in the area; please be cautious
